I have!

Just bolt-ons, on my 5.3L 3.73s

With:
K&N PFIK Cold Air
TB Coolant Bypass
Mobil 1 Full-Synthetic Engine Oil
Nelson Performance Custom 93 Tune!!
180 Thermostat
NGK TR55 Spark Plugs
MSD 8.5mm Wires
LS1 Electric Fans
Flex-a-lite VSC
ASP Underdrive Crank Pulley
AC Delco 150A Alternator
Pacesetter Long Tube Headers
Pacesetter 3" Catless Y-Pipe
40 Series Flowmaster

Oh ya, and a touch of lean!

Today i made 280.02 hp and292.27 tq.This was after i had installed a stall which lowers your power to wheels a decent bit as everyone knows.We retuned the truck and got about 6 extra hp over the base line pulls.My numbers before the verter where 288.97 hp and 307.66 tq.
So if i was just tryin to hit a number with a stock verter and a short belt i could ahve over 300 no problem.
O yea my base pull compared to before the verter was like i said 288.97hp today with the verter base pulls i was at 274.xxhp...So the verter caused a decent drop as well as my tq came down to 283.xx
Like i said if i was worried about a number stock verter and short belt would get me there.
BTW:This was done at 95.25degrees and 24%humidity.

Dyno testing with the converter locked will help reduce drivetrain losses.

If an Ls1 can dyno at 290-325 rwhp stock, than I think a 5.3 should be able to hit 300 rwhp with bolt ons and tuning.

An aluminum block L33 with its slightly different heads, cam and compression ratio should be able to hit the mark a tad easier than an iron block LM7 5.3.
